Brasserie Dieu du Ciel! Grande Noirceur

Grande Noirceur

 

Brasserie Dieu du Ciel! in Saint-Jérôme, Quebec, Canada 🇨🇦

  Stout - Imperial Regular
Score
7.79
ABV: 9.0% IBU: - Ticks: 165
The Grande Noirceur is an intensely black and dense beer with pronounced roasted flavours. The bitterness is very imposing but is balanced by a malty-caramel taste. The alcohol content is quite high, but its presence remains discrete in this beer.

8.4/10 Appearance 8 Aroma 9 Flavor 9 Texture 8 Overall 7.5
340 ml bottle. Dark black. Dense tan head is small and fleeting. Roasted malt nose has metallic notes. Rich roasted malt flavor. Soy sauce, smoked ham, charred wood, burnt sugar and ash. Bitter smoky finish.

8/10 Appearance 8 Aroma 8 Flavor 8 Texture 8 Overall 8
Bottle at home. Pitch black with brown head. Deep roast, leather, quite fruity with blue and black berries, toffee, ash, cocoa. Very nice mix between bitter roast, and malty and fruity sweetness. Almost full bodied with soft carbonation. Lovely beer.

7.6/10 Appearance 8 Aroma 7 Flavor 8 Texture 8 Overall 7.5
From the tap at FOB, Rimini, Italy. Pours black with brownish foam. Aroma is hazelnut, light coffee notes, a fruity note. Body is medium-dense. Taste is predominantly bitter and roasted, though there’s a little of underlying sweetness. Finish is long and roasted/bitter.

8.4/10 Appearance 8 Aroma 8 Flavor 9 Texture 8 Overall 8.5
Bottle from the LCBO. Inky black with a small dark mahogany head that fades quickly to a sheet. Nose is lots of roast, molasses, coffee, dark chocolate, dark fruit, with notes of licorice, vanilla and minerals. Taste is light sweet molasses with a much more pronounced coffee and chocolate bitterness and a touch of plum tartness. Mouth is medium+ and chewy with soft carbonation and a lingering bitter finish. 8+/4/9/4/17

8.5/10 Appearance 8 Aroma 9 Flavor 9 Texture 8 Overall 8
Bottle shared at the November THT at deanso’s place. Pitch black with a thin tan head. Notes of both brewed and roasted coffee, chocolate, roasted malts, molasses. Full body, smooth texture and a roasty, chocolatey bitter-sweet finish.
